Q.Can You Please Identify What Is Causing Brown Areas On Our Honeycrisp Apples?

Zone Roundup, MT 59072 Zone 4 | Betty Mallory added on September 11, 2023 | Answered

Not all the apples are affected. We covered the apples in mid June with small mesh bags to prevent bugs. Have looked at many websites but have not seen photos that look like our apples. We hope you can help us. We live in central Montana. Had 7 inches of rain in June. Tree is watered with Thank you.

This looks to be black rot and requires control rather than treatment. A fungicide wouldn't hurt, though. Here is an article that will help:
